What Is A Flex Pipe Catalytic Converter?

A flex pipe catalytic converter is a component of the vehicle’s exhaust system that helps reduce emissions. It contains a catalytic converter and a flexible pipe, which allows for movement and prevents damage to the exhaust system. This combination improves exhaust flow and reduces noise.

How Does A Flex Pipe Catalytic Converter Work?

A flex pipe catalytic converter works by using a catalyst to convert harmful gases into less harmful substances. When exhaust gases pass through the converter, the catalyst facilitates chemical reactions that break down pollutants and convert them into carbon dioxide, water vapor, and nitrogen.

This process helps to reduce emissions and protect the environment.

Are There Different Types Of Flex Pipe Catalytic Converters?

Yes, there are different types of flex pipe catalytic converters available in the market. They vary in design, materials, and compatibility with specific vehicle models. Some common types include universal fit catalytic converters, direct-fit catalytic converters, and high-flow catalytic converters.

Choosing the right type depends on the vehicle’s make, model, and local emission regulations.
